US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"for another end"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to indicate a different purpose or goal than what has been previously mentioned. Example: "She pursued her studies for another end, aiming to contribute to environmental conservation."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When using "for another end", ensure the context clearly distinguishes it from the previous purpose or goal to avoid ambiguity.

Common error

Avoid using "for another end" when the intended purpose is merely a continuation or extension of the original goal. Instead, use phrases like "furthermore" or "in addition" to maintain clarity.

FAQs

How can I use "for another end" in a sentence?

You can use "for another end" to indicate a different purpose or goal than what was previously mentioned. For example, "She pursued her studies "for another end", aiming to contribute to environmental conservation".

What's a formal alternative to "for another end"?

In formal contexts, you might consider using "for a different purpose" or "with an alternative objective" instead of "for another end".

Is it correct to say "for another end"?

Yes, it's a grammatically correct phrase. However, ensure its usage is clear and contextually appropriate. According to Ludwig AI, the phrase is correct and usable in written English.

What's the difference between "for another end" and "for the end"?

"For another end" implies a different or additional purpose, while "for the end" typically refers to something done specifically to reach a conclusion or finality.
